      <description>&lt;P&gt;Hi Guys&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;I have a wordpress site which is public, and gets SEO traffic. However, I have a download page in WP which I don't want to show in the SERPS for obvious reasons. There is an option to make the page Private, but then only I can get to it by being logged in. There is a third option which is to password protect the page, which I don't really want to do either. So, how do I make the page accessible to people if I give them the link, but not having the page picked up by going, especially if people are searching for my product with the word "download".&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;____&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;DIV&gt;Orthohin &lt;IMG src="http://imagicon.info/cat/12-1/text-smiley.png" /&gt;&lt;/DIV&gt;</description>

      <description>&lt;P&gt;You can use the htaccess or robots.txt files or even the &amp;lt;meta&amp;gt; tags&amp;nbsp; with the 'noindex' attribute&am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p; to control&amp;nbsp; the behaviour of search bots.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Another trick is to check the referer value of all visitors entering the page using&amp;nbsp; PHP/ASP or Javascript and kick them back to the sites home page if they attempt to come direct from Google to a download page. Wordpress probably does not have a plugin specifically to implement this but it should be a fairly simple tweek to include it to the WP template.&lt;/P&gt;</description>
